
@media only screen and (max-width: 800px) {
    .jsmpa_sjd2022{display: block}
    .jsmpa_pcd2022{display: none}

*{margin: 0;padding: 0;border: 0;list-style: none;text-decoration: none;color: inherit;font-weight: normal;font-family: "微软雅黑";box-sizing: border-box;font-style: normal;outline: none;-webkit-tap-highlight-color: transparent;}
body{width: 100%;overflow-x: hidden;background: #fff;color: #ffffff;}
img{vertical-align: middle;max-width: 100%;}
/*头部*/
.mobile_top{width: 7.5rem;height: 1.73rem;}
.mobile_top_con{width: 100%;height: 1.73rem;background-image: url("mobile_logo_bg.png");background-repeat: no-repeat;background-position: right;background-size: 3.48rem 1.73rem;}
/*logo*/
.mobile_logo{width: 4.43rem;height: 1.73rem;margin-left: .32rem;float: left;}
.mobile_logo img{width: 4.43rem;height: .72rem;margin-top: .6rem;}
/*搜索框*/
.mobile_search{background-color: #efefef;width: 7.5rem;height: 1.2rem;}
.mobile_search input{border: none;width: 6.26rem;height: .76rem;font-size: .28rem;color: #999;background-color: #fff;margin-left: .2rem;padding-left: .3rem;line-height: 1.2rem;}
.mobile_search a{font-size: .32rem;color: #333;line-height: 1.2rem;}
/*导航*/
.mobile_nav{width: 100%;height: 1.6rem;background-color: #2a418e;}
.mobile_nav_con{width:7.1rem;font-size:.36rem;line-height: .8rem;margin: 0 auto;}
.mobile_nav_con li{float: left;width: 2.3rem;text-align: center;}
    .mobile_nav_con li a{color: #fff}
/*重点新闻*/
.mobile_xwzx_zdxw{width: 100%;margin: .1rem auto;}
.mobile_zdxw_t{font-size: .48rem;color: #333;font-weight: bolder;width: 7.1rem;height: 1.16rem;line-height: 1.16rem;text-align: center;overflow:hidden;white-space: nowrap;text-overflow: ellipsis;margin: 0 auto;}
.mobile_zdxw_t a{color: #333;font-weight: bolder;text-align: center;}
.mobile_xwzx_zdxw p{font-size: .32rem;color: #333;width: 7.1rem;margin: 0 auto;overflow:hidden;white-space: nowrap;text-overflow: ellipsis;}
/*图片新闻轮播*/
.mobile_xwzx_tpxw{width: 7.1rem;height: 3.4rem;margin: 0.3rem auto;}
.mobile_xwzx_tpxw img{width: 7.1rem;height: 3.4rem;}
/* index_focus */
.mobile_xwzx_tpxw .index_focus{position:relative;width:100%;height:3.4rem;margin:0 auto;overflow:hidden;}
.mobile_xwzx_tpxw  .index_focus .bd li{display:none;position:absolute;left:0;top:0;}
.mobile_xwzx_tpxw  .index_focus_post{z-index:10;}
.mobile_xwzx_tpxw  .index_focus .pic:hover{text-decoration:none;}
.mobile_xwzx_tpxw  .index_focus .slide_nav{position:absolute;right: .1rem;bottom:0;}
.mobile_xwzx_tpxw  .index_focus .slide_nav a{cursor:pointer;float:left;font-size:.6rem;font-family:arial;color:#5b5b5d;line-height: 1rem;}
.mobile_xwzx_tpxw  .index_focus .slide_nav li:hover,.mobile_xwzx_tpxw .index_focus .slide_nav .on{text-decoration:none;color:#fff;filter:alpha(opacity=80);opacity:0.8;}
.mobile_xwzx_tpxw  .index_focus_pre,.mobile_xwzx_tpxw  .index_focus_next{display:none;position:absolute;top:50%;margin-top:-.36rem;width:.72rem;height:.72rem;text-indent:100%;white-space:nowrap;overflow:hidden;z-index:10;}
.mobile_xwzx_tpxw  .index_focus_pre{left:.3rem;background-position:0 0;}
.mobile_xwzx_tpxw  .index_focus_pre:hover{background-position:0 -1.4rem;}
.mobile_xwzx_tpxw  .index_focus_next{right:.3rem;background-position:0 -.72rem;}
.mobile_xwzx_tpxw  .index_focus_next:hover{background-position:0 -2.16rem;}
.mobile_xwzx_tpxw  .index_focus_info{position:absolute;left:0;bottom:0;width:100%;height:1rem;color:#fff;text-decoration:none;cursor:pointer;background:rgba(0,0,0,0.5) ;line-height: 1rem}
.mobile_xwzx_tpxw  .index_focus_info .text{width:4.45rem;line-height:1rem;font-size:.38rem;word-wrap:break-word;overflow:hidden;display:none;height: 1rem;float: left;margin-left: .14rem;
    overflow:hidden;
    white-space: nowrap;
    text-overflow: ellipsis;}
/*新闻资讯*/
.dx{background: #2a418e;color: #fff !important;}
.mobile_xwzx_xw{width: 7.1rem;height: 7rem;margin: 0 auto;}
.mobile_wxzx_nav{width: 100%;height: .86rem;line-height: .86rem;border-bottom: .02rem solid #e5e5e5}
.mobile_wxzx_nav li{float: left;width: auto;height: .86rem;font-size: .36rem;color: #333;}
.mobile_wxzx_nav li a{float: left;width: 100%;height: 100%;padding: 0 .1rem;}
.mobile_xwzx_con{width: 7.1rem;height: auto;display: none}
.mobile_xwzx_zd{width: 100%;height: 2.08rem;border-bottom: .02rem solid #e5e5e5;padding-top: .44rem;padding-bottom: .20rem;float: left}
.mobile_xwzx_rq{width: 1.32rem;border-right: .02rem solid #2a418e;float: left;}
.mobile_xwzx_rq span{float: left;width: 100%;text-align: center;color: #555}
.mobile_xwzx_rq span:first-child{font-size: .8rem;}
.mobile_xwzx_rq span:last-child{font-size: .28rem}
.mobile_xwzx_nr{width: 5.46rem;height: .62rem;float: right;padding-right: .05rem;}
.mobile_xwzx_nr a{line-height: .36rem;height: .62rem;font-size: .36rem;width: 5.52rem;text-align: center;float: left;color: #333; overflow:hidden;
    white-space: nowrap;
    text-overflow: ellipsis;}
.mobile_xwzx_nr a:hover{color: #2a418e}
.mobile_xwzx_nr p{float: left;width: 100%;line-height: .40rem;font-size: .30rem;color: #555555;overflow:hidden;display: -webkit-box;-webkit-line-clamp: 2;-webkit-box-orient: vertical; }
.mobile_xwzx_con li{width: 100%;height: .54rem;line-height: .60rem;font-size: .32rem;margin-top: .36rem;float: left}
.mobile_xwzx_con li span,.mobile_xwzx_con li a{float: left;}
.mobile_xwzx_con li span:first-child{padding: 0 10px;border-right: .02rem solid #e5e5e5;color: #333}
.mobile_xwzx_con li span:last-child{color: #999}
.mobile_xwzx_con li a{width: 4.6rem;margin-left: .2rem;overflow:hidden;white-space: nowrap;text-overflow: ellipsis;color: #333;}
.mobile_xwzx_con li a:hover{font-weight: bold;color: #2a418e}
/*旗舰店横幅*/
.mobile_qjd{width: 7.1rem;height: 1.76rem;margin: 0 auto;}
.mobile_qjd img{width: 7.1rem;height: 1.76rem;}
/*公告通知*/
.mobile_ggtz{width: 7.1rem;height: auto;border: .02rem solid #c1cfe5;margin-bottom: .4rem;overflow: hidden;padding-bottom: .4rem;margin: .5rem auto;
    -webkit-border-radius:.08rem;
    -moz-border-radius:.08rem;
    border-radius:.08rem;}
.mobile_ggtz_t{width: 100%;height: 1rem;border-bottom: .02rem solid #dcdcdc;background: #f3f4f7;line-height: 1rem;}
.mobile_ggtz_t a{height: 1rem;color: #2a418e;font-size: .4rem;font-weight: bold;float: left;line-height: 1rem;text-indent: .1rem;padding-right: .2rem;}
.dx1{background: url("mobile_ggtz1.png") no-repeat .2rem center;border-bottom: .04rem solid #2a418e;padding-left:.8rem;background-size: .58rem .58rem; }
.mobile_ggtz_c{width: 100%;height: auto;padding: 0 .1rem}
.mobile_ggtz_c li{float: left;width: 100%;height: .42rem;line-height: .40rem;margin-top: .4rem;font-size: .32rem;}
.mobile_ggtz_c li img{float: left;margin-top: .1rem;margin-left: .1rem;margin-right: .1rem;width: .18rem;height: .18rem;}
.mobile_ggtz_c li a{float: left;width: 66%;height: .40rem;color: #333333;
    overflow:hidden;
    white-space: nowrap;
    text-overflow: ellipsis;}
.mobile_ggtz_c li a:hover{color: #2a418e;font-weight: bold}
.mobile_ggtz_c li span{float: right;color: #999999}
/*数据查询*/
.dx3{background: url("mobile_sjcx2.png") no-repeat .2rem center;border-bottom: .04rem solid #2a418e;padding-left:.8rem;background-size: .61rem .60rem; }
.mobile_sjcx_c{width: 100%;height: auto;padding-top: .5rem;overflow: hidden;padding-bottom: .2rem}
.mobile_sjcx_c li{float: left;width: 25%;height: 2rem;text-align: center}
.mobile_sjcx_c li img{float: left;margin-top: .16rem;margin-left: .4rem;margin-bottom: .1rem;width: .89rem;height: .89rem;}
.mobile_sjcx_c li span{float: left;width: 100%;line-height: .6rem;font-size: .4rem;color: #333333}
.mobile_sjcx_c li{border-right: .02rem dashed #999;}
    .mobile_sjcx_c li:last-child{border: none !important;}
.mobile_sjcx_c li span:hover{color: #2a418e}
/*法律法规*/
.dx2{background: url("mobile_ggtz1.png") no-repeat .2rem center;border-bottom: .04rem solid #2a418e;padding-left:.8rem; background-size: .58rem .58rem;}
.mobile_flfg_c{display: none}
/*信息公开*/
.dx4{background: url("mobile_xxkg.png") no-repeat .2rem center;border-bottom: .04rem solid #2a418e;padding-left:.8rem; background-size: .50rem .56rem;}
.mobile_xxgk_c{width: 100%;height: auto;padding-left:.40rem;overflow: hidden;padding-right: .3rem;padding-top: .3rem;padding-bottom: .2rem}
.mobile_xxgk_c li{float: left;width:3.04rem;height: 1rem;border: .02rem solid #2a418e;line-height: .9rem;padding-left: .6rem;font-size: .32rem;margin-top: .2rem;
    -webkit-border-radius:.1rem;
    -moz-border-radius:.1rem;
    border-radius:.1rem;}
.mobile_xxgk_c li a{color: #2a418e;padding-left: .2rem;}
.mobile_xxgk_c li a:hover{font-weight: bold}
.mobile_xxgk_c li img:first-child{float: left;margin-top: .2rem;background-size: 100% 100%;height: .5rem;}
.mobile_xxgk_c li:first-child{margin-right: .2rem}
.mobile_xxgk_c li:last-child{margin-left: .2rem;}
/*交流互动*/
.dx5{background: url("mobile_jlhd.png") no-repeat .2rem center;border-bottom: .04rem solid #2a418e;padding-left:.8rem; background-size: .51rem .51rem;}
.mobile_jlhd_c{width: 100%;height: auto;padding-left:.3rem;overflow: hidden;padding-right: .3rem;padding-top: .3rem;padding-bottom: .16rem;}
.mobile_jlhd_c li{width: 23%;height: 1.6rem;border: .02rem solid #ececec;text-align: center;float: left;margin-top: .2rem;}
.mobile_jlhd_c li img{float: left;margin-top: .3rem;margin-left: .4rem;height: .63rem;}
.mobile_jlhd_c li span{float: left;width: 100%;line-height: .6rem;font-size: .32rem;color: #333333}
.mobile_jlhd_c li:nth-child(2){margin-right: 3%;margin-left: 3%}
    .mobile_jlhd_c li:nth-child(3){margin-right: 2%;}
.mobile_jlhd_c li span:hover{color: #2a418e}
/*应用系统*/
.mobile_yyxt{width: 7.1rem;height: auto;overflow: hidden;margin: 0 auto;}
.mobile_yyxt span{width: 2.25rem;height: .04rem;background-color: #DCDCDC;display: inline-block;vertical-align: middle;}
.mobile_yyxt span:first-child{margin-right: .2rem;}
.mobile_yyxt span:last-child{margin-left: .2rem;}
.mobile_yyxt_t{width:100%;height: .4rem;line-height: .4rem;font-weight: bold;font-size: .4rem;text-align: center;color: #2a418e;vertical-align: middle;display: inline-block;padding: 0 .2rem;}
.mobile_yyxt .mobile_yyxt_c{width: 100%;height: auto;overflow: hidden;background: #fff;margin: .2rem auto;}
.mobile_yyxt .mobile_yyxt_c li a{float: left;margin-right: .2rem;margin-top: .3rem;}
/*.mobile_yyxt .index_focus{position:relative;width:100%;height:3rem;margin:0 auto;overflow:hidden;}
.mobile_yyxt .index_focus .bd li{display:none;position:absolute;left:0;top:0;}
.mobile_yyxt .index_focus_post{z-index:10;}
.mobile_yyxt .index_focus .pic:hover{text-decoration:none;}
.mobile_yyxt .index_focus .slide_nav{position:absolute;right: .1rem;bottom:0;}
.mobile_yyxt .index_focus .slide_nav a{cursor:pointer;float:left;font-size:.6rem;font-family:arial;color:#2a418e;line-height: 1rem;}
.mobile_yyxt .index_focus .slide_nav li:hover,.mobile_yyxt .index_focus .slide_nav .on{text-decoration:none;color:#2a418e;filter:alpha(opacity=80);opacity:0.8;}
.mobile_yyxt .index_focus_pre,.mobile_yyxt.index_focus_next{display:none;position:absolute;top:50%;margin-top:-.36rem;width:.72rem;height:.72rem;text-indent:100%;white-space:nowrap;overflow:hidden;z-index:10;}
.mobile_yyxt .index_focus_pre{left:.3rem;background-position:0 0;}
.mobile_yyxt .index_focus_pre:hover{background-position:0 -1.4rem;}
.mobile_yyxt .index_focus_next{right:.3rem;background-position:0 -.72rem;}
.mobile_yyxt .index_focus_next:hover{background-position:0 -2.16rem;}
.mobile_yyxt .index_focus_info{position:absolute;left:0;bottom:0;width:100%;height:1rem;color:#fff;text-decoration:none;cursor:pointer;background:rgba(0,0,0,0.5) ;line-height: 1rem}
.mobile_yyxt .index_focus_info .text{width:4.45rem;line-height:1rem;font-size:.38rem;word-wrap:break-word;overflow:hidden;display:none;height: 1rem;float: left;margin-left: .14rem;
    overflow:hidden;
    white-space: nowrap;
    text-overflow: ellipsis;}*/

    .index_focus{height: auto}


/*底部*/
.mobile_bottom{width: 100%;height: auto;border-top: .06rem solid #2a418e;margin-top: .2rem;}
.mobile_bottom_con{width:7.1rem;height: auto;margin: 0 auto;overflow: hidden}
.mobile_bottom_con_txt{width:6rem;height: 4.6rem; overflow: hidden;text-align: center;margin: 0 auto;}
.mobile_bottom_con_txt p{width: 100%;height: .5rem;line-height: .5rem;text-align: center;color: #333;font-size: .28rem;}
.mobile_bottom_con_pic{text-align: center;margin-top: .5rem;}
.mobile_bottom_con_pic .mobile_dzjg{width: .8rem;height: 1rem;}
.mobile_bottom_con_pic .mobie_jc{width: 1.34rem;height: .61rem;}
/*智能问答悬浮*/
.mobile_znwd{position: fixed;bottom: .6rem;right: .2rem;display: block;width: 1.16rem;height: 1.16rem;cursor: pointer;background-image: url("mobile_znwd_xf.png");background-position: center;background-repeat: no-repeat;background-size: 1.16rem 1.16rem;}
}